What are the latest songs and music albums for Contemporary Hip Hop musician Willie Evans Jr?

With his most recent tracks and albums, Florida-born contemporary hip-hop performer Willie Evans Jr. has been creating waves in the music industry. The 2016 publication of his most recent CD, "Clean Plate Club, Vol. 2," demonstrates his development as an artist and his creative range. His distinct approach is evident in the songs on this album, which combine aspects of hip-hop with other genres to produce an alluring sound. He has a number of standout tracks, like "Introducin'" from his 2011 album of the same name, which demonstrates his lyrical talent and musical prowess.

Willie Evans Jr. has released notable singles in addition to his albums, which have drawn praise from both critics and fans. The 2018 song "The Whole World is Jockin' Me" demonstrates his talent for writing insightful lyrics over memorable melodies. Another standout track is "I Heart Jet Noise" from 2017, which perfectly encapsulates his avant-garde approach to hip-hop, pushing boundaries and producing a singular aural experience.

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Contemporary Hip Hop musician Willie Evans Jr?

American contemporary hip-hop musician Willie Evans Jr. has worked with a number of eminent musicians over the course of his career. The song "Make Good Art Pt. 2," which he collaborated on with Professor Elemental and Jesse Dangerously, is one of his most significant works. Evans' capacity to collaborate with artists from many backgrounds and meld their individual approaches together is demonstrated through this project. Professor Elemental and Jesse Dangerously and Evans' distinctive production technique combine to create a compelling and thought-provoking piece of music.

The song "Still Here," which also contains Batsauce, Qwel, Denizen Kane, and Typical Cats, is a noteworthy collaboration for Evans. This collaboration demonstrates Evans' skill at uniting a wide range of musicians to produce a unified sound. A dynamic and interesting listening experience is produced as a result of each artist adding their own distinct flavor to the piece. The song "Still Here" demonstrates Evans' talent for assembling bands that push the boundaries of hip hop and create something new and inventive.

Evans and Tom Caruana also worked together on the song "Sandbag Veteran." Evans' capacity to collaborate with producers and musicians outside of his own group is demonstrated by this project. Evans' lyrical flow is complemented by Caruana's production, creating a song that is both catchy and thought-provoking. The song "Sandbag Veteran" exemplifies Evans' artistic diversity and openness to discovering new sound vistas.

Overall, these partnerships show how Willie Evans Jr. can work with a variety of musicians to produce music that is both inventive and alluring. Evans has been able to stretch the boundaries of hip hop and provide original and compelling musical experiences because to his partnerships.
